What is a superior court affidavit?

An affidavit is a written statement confirmed by oath or affirmation, used as evidence in court. In Arizona, affidavits serve various legal purposes, such as supporting a motion or providing testimony without appearing in person. Accurately completing an affidavit is crucial, as it can impact your case significantly.

What common challenges arise when filling out the affidavit?

Many individuals encounter challenges during the affidavit filling process, which underscores the importance of understanding the common pitfalls and how to overcome them.
  • Leaving fields blank can result in delays or rejection; always check for completeness before submitting.
  • Mistakes in names, dates, or case numbers can lead to significant issues, so double-check all entries.
  • Be prepared to provide supporting documents alongside your affidavit if required by the court.

How do ensure legal compliance?

Legal compliance is crucial when submitting affidavits in Arizona. Ensuring that your document meets all requirements can prevent legal complications in the future.
  • Certain affidavits require notarization to affirm the authenticity of the signature; know the requirements relevant to your affidavit.
  • Stay informed about state-specific regulations regarding affidavit submissions, including any recent changes.
  • Be aware that incomplete or incorrect affidavits can lead to legal repercussions, including delayed proceedings.
